    Abstract: A compact automatic transmission for a vehicle capable of preventing increase in relative rotational speed between shift elements. A planetary gear unit is provided with a sun gear to which rotation of an input shaft is input, a carrier that can be stopped from rotating, and a ring gear for outputting, to a planetary gear set, rotation that is reduced in speed relative to that of the input shaft. A clutch is connected/disconnected, the input shaft and the sun gear are appropriately connected/disconnected, and the carrier is appropriately stopped/unstopped by a brake and a one-way clutch. This prevents relative rotational speed between shift elements of the gear unit that does not participate in a shifting operation from excessively increasing. When the clutch is disposed between the input shaft and the sun gear, the torque capacity of the clutch can be reduced as compared with the case where it is disposed between the gear unit and the gear set.

    Abstract: The present invention provides a multilayer ceramic capacitor in which electrode metal layers and dielectric ceramic layers are laminated alternately and its dielectric constant peak is present at a temperature below −50° C. The multilayer ceramic capacitor is at least one selected from a multilayer ceramic capacitor to be incorporated into an electric circuit in which an electric field of at least 200 V/mm is applied to dielectric layers as a DC bias electric field and an alternating current at a frequency of at least 20 kHz is superimposed and a multilayer ceramic capacitor to be incorporated into an electric circuit in which an electric field of at least 200 V/mm is applied to dielectric layers as an AC electric field. As the dielectric ceramic, a ceramic containing lead atoms whose amount is indicated by being measured in the form of PbO, which is at least 30 mol %, particularly a compound with a perovskite structure represented by ABO3 is used.

    Abstract: A resin composition which exhibits good sealability while keeping creep deformation to a minimum when brought into sliding contact with a mating member at a high contact pressure of over 10 MPa, and which will not damage a mating member made from an aluminum alloy while sliding in contact with lubricating oil. The resin composition is a pressure-resistant, sliding tetrafluoroethylene resin composition containing 100 parts by volume of a modified tetrafluoroethylene resin in the form of a copolymer of tetrafluoroethylene and partially modified tetrafluoroethylene, 5-40 parts by volume of carbon fiber, and 2-30 parts by volume of calcium sulfate whiskers having a Mohs hardness of 4 or less, and having, at 100° C., a maximum deformation rate in 24 hours, of 15% or less. A seal device to be brought into slide contact with an aluminum metal is molded from such a pressure-resistant, sliding tetrafluoroethylene resin composition.

    Abstract: A direct current output voltage is switched by two switching units and a current alternately changing directions is supplied to a primary winding of a transformer. An alternating voltage induced in a secondary winding of the transformer is rectified and smoothed, and is applied to a control circuit. A bidirectional switching unit is connected in parallel with the primary winding, and is controlled by the control circuit so that the primary winding is short-circuited by the bidirectional switching unit and an exciting energy of the transformer is held continuously.

    Abstract: A switching power supply device which includes a series circuit constituted by a first switching element which is connected to an input voltage and which is at least repeatedly turned on and off and a second switching element which is repeatedly turned on and off alternating with the first switching element. A first capacitor is connected to one end of the second switching element. A transformer having a primary winding is connected to the second switching element and the first capacitor. A series circuit constituted by a second capacitor and a rectifier diode is connected across the secondary winding of the transformer, and a series circuit constituted by an inductance element and a smoothing capacitor is connected across the rectifier diode. A control circuit controls the turning on and off of the first and second switching elements based on the voltage across the smoothing capacitor. The voltage across the smoothing capacitor is supplied as the output.

    Abstract: An AC-DC converter which allows an input current of an input AC power source to have harmonic currents of reduced levels and which supplies a stabilized output DC voltage to a load is realized by a simple circuit configuration. The converter has: a converter circuit consisting of a choke coil which receives a rectified voltage from a rectifying circuit, a switch element, and a diode; a smoothing capacitor which smooths the output voltage of the converter circuit and supplies the smoothed voltage to a load; and a control circuit consisting of a current detection circuit, a voltage detection circuit, and a pulse-width control circuit. In order to stabilize the output voltage, the switch element is turned on and off so that the peak value of the input current of the converter circuit is limited in a DC-like manner, thereby allowing the input current to have a trapezoidal waveform.

    Abstract: A switching power supply supplies a regulated output voltage for an electronic apparatus in industrial or commercial use and suppresses generation of a spike voltage and a spike current due to a transformer, and a recovery voltage of a rectifying diode due to switching and it results in reduction of noise interference and power loss. A series connection of a first switching means and a second switching means repeating on/off action alternately is connected to a d-c source. A series connection of a first capacitor and a primary winding of a transformer is connected in parallel with the second switching means. An induced voltage in a secondary winding is supplied to an output through a rectifying/filtering means. A series resonance current in a closed circuit comprising the first capacitor and a leakage inductance suppresses spike voltage, spike current, and recovery voltage of the rectifying diode.
